About this site

This site has been created to allow fans of McLaren Vale boutique wineries to find the best of the Vale in one spot. Our definition of "boutique" is any winery producing fewer than 2500 cases per year. These wineries produce high quality, small batch wines, and are hard to come by. Being on a mailing list is often the only way to purchase these wines.

Adrian Kenny

It is Finished!

After five months and one week the 2009 fruit intake has ended! It's certainly been the longest vintage I've ever been involved in. Gruelling by any measure, though an absolute thrill to be a part of nine different white varietals, six different red varietals and four different wine styles. Sheer Bedlam!
